Court Coordinator for Child Protection Courts

Office of the Court Administration
02.2022 - 08.2023
  • Coordinate the dockets for the Child Protection Courts in Fort Bend, Galveston and Wharton by a daily interaction by email and in person with Assistant District Attorneys, Attorneys from the parties, respective paralegals and Case workers from DFPS.
  • Manage the operations of the Child Protection Court in Fort Bend, Galveston and Wharton: set up of appropriate media technology, secure venue, court reporters, interpreters, and bailiffs.
  • Schedule all hearings following the rules of procedure for Child Protection Cases in court.
  • Process Assignments and Claims for Visiting Judges in the 11th Administrative Region.
  • Keep the records of the hearings updated and when appropriate release them in a timely fashion manner.
  • Manage Judge's schedule.

Family Paralegal

Assistance to Victims of Domestic Abuse (AVDA)
09.2019 - 01.2022

Provided daily legal and administrative assistance to 2 AVDA's attorneys.

  • Managed to note every step/action taken in an average of 50 cases with the management recording system of AVDA.
  • Organized personal data and all communications with clients and parties, including evidence and court-filed documents using physical and electronic storage space .
  • Drafted the Applications for Protective Order, Agreed Orders, Temporary Protective Orders, Motions, Proposed Final Protective Orders, Exhibits and Witness Lists.
  • Suggested possible exhibits in the case to the attorney. Prepared Exhibits for Hearings.
  • Managed from initial consultation to the signing and delivery of the Protective Order, the entire process to obtain a Protective Order, with minimal supervision.
  • Proficiently used E-Filing in State Courts though Texas E-file.
  • Communicated with Court's clerks, Court Coordinator and Court Reporters, to obtain relevant information in the cases.
  • Communicated daily with the Constable/Deputy in charge of the notification of the Protective Order to the Defendants, within the county, the state and the US.
  • Coordinated with the Court Coordinator to obtain and schedule hearings and set entry dates.
  • Interact with clients, who were survivors of domestic violence, via phone, email and mail to obtain/deliver pertinent information of the case in progress.
  • Translate documents from English to Spanish, and vice versa, as well as Interpreting during consultations.
  • Used diverse communication channels (drop box, fax, postal and courier mail) to manage court related documentation with the court and opposite attorney.
  • Procured training of paralegals for other AVDA Offices on the Protection Order procedure.
  • Obtained training on Divorce and Custody Orders procedure.
